A plugin is a small folder of code that the bot loads at startup. It can add diagnostics, react to account events, register selector groups, read its own settings, keep a little storage, and show a panel in Rewards Desk — all without touching the bot's source and (for community plugins) without any Node.js access. This page walks through a complete plugin from empty folder to running, then points you to publishing.
Plugins use the public plugin API. They cannot register premium Core tasks or grant premium entitlements — those are reserved for the official Core plugin.
Every plugin lives in its own folder under plugins/. The folder name should match the plugin's name.
plugins/summary/
├── index.js # the plugin code (or index.jsc for compiled plugins)
├── package.json # name, version, metadata
└── README.md # what it does and every config key
A plugin is a class (or factory) that exposes a name, a version, and a register(context) method. Lifecycle hooks such as onAccountEnd are optional.
class SummaryPlugin {
name = 'summary'
version = '1.0.0'
botVersionRange = '>=4.0.0'
capabilities = ['diagnostics']
// Called once when the bot starts and the plugin is enabled.
register(context) {
// context.config is this plugin's "config" block from plugins.jsonc
this.config = context.config || {}
context.log.info('main', 'SUMMARY', 'Summary plugin loaded')
context.registerDiagnostics(() => [
{ level: 'info', message: 'Summary plugin is active' }
])
}
// Called after each account finishes its run.
onAccountEnd({ log, result }) {
log.info('main', 'SUMMARY', `${result.email}: +${result.collectedPoints} points`)
}
}

You can also flip plugins on and off from the Plugins page in Rewards Desk — it edits this same file for you.
Start the bot with npm start. When the plugin loads you'll see this in the console (and in the Desk Console page):
Registered plugin: [email protected]
If it doesn't appear, check that the folder name matches name, that enabled is true, and that index.js exports the class.
These three capabilities let a plugin have its own little UI and memory without Node.js access and without patching the Desk. They work identically whether your plugin runs sandboxed (community) or in-process (first-party).
Ship a plugin.json next to index.js. It is the static source of truth the Desk reads to draw your settings form — your code never runs just to show settings.
{
"name": "earnings-estimator",
"version": "1.0.0",
"permissions": ["settings", "storage", "ui.panel", "points.read"],
"settings": [
{ "key": "pointsPerEuro", "type": "number", "label": "Points per €", "default": 1500, "min": 1 },
{ "key": "days", "type": "number", "label": "Days to project", "default": 30, "min": 1, "max": 3650 }
]

module.exports = {
name: 'earnings-estimator',
version: '1.0.0',
register(ctx) { render(ctx) },
onAccountEnd(ctx) {
const total = (Number(ctx.storage.get('totalPoints')) || 0) + (ctx.result.collectedPoints || 0)
ctx.storage.set('totalPoints', total) // persists across runs, scoped to this plugin
render(ctx)
}
}
function render(ctx) {
const euros = (Number(ctx.storage.get('totalPoints')) || 0) / (ctx.settings.pointsPerEuro || 1500)
ctx.ui.panel({ // shown in the Desk Plugins page — no HTML, a fixed vocabulary
title: 'Earnings estimate',
stats: [{ label: 'Worth now', value: euros.toFixed(2) + ' €' }]
})
}ctx.settings— resolved values: schema defaults, thenplugins.jsoncconfig, then what the user set in the Desk.ctx.storage—get/set/delete/keys, JSON only, size-capped, persisted underplugins/.data/<name>/.ctx.ui.panel(data)— replaces your plugin's panel: atitle, labelledstats, and textlines. It is not HTML and plugins cannot create new Desk pages — everything renders inside your card on the one Plugins page.

- Match the names. The folder name, the
namefield, and theplugins.jsonckey should all be identical. - Document every config key in your README so users know what they're turning on.
- Stay on the public API. Don't reach into internal or Core APIs — they change without notice and are reserved for the paid plugin.
- Declare a version range. Use
botVersionRange(for example>=4.0.0) so the bot can warn on mismatches. - Fail soft. If your plugin can't do its job, log a warning and return — never crash the run.
